Class: Kaltura::KalturaLiveAsset

Inherits:
KalturaFlavorAsset show all
Defined in:
lib/kaltura_types.rb

Instance Attribute Summary collapse

Attributes inherited from KalturaFlavorAsset

#bitrate, #container_format, #flavor_params_id, #frame_rate, #height, #is_default, #is_original, #is_web, #label, #language, #status, #video_codec_id, #width

Attributes inherited from KalturaAsset

#actual_source_asset_params_ids, #created_at, #deleted_at, #description, #entry_id, #file_ext, #id, #partner_data, #partner_description, #partner_id, #size, #tags, #updated_at, #version

Attributes inherited from KalturaObjectBase

#object_type, #related_objects

Instance Method Summary collapse

Methods inherited from KalturaObjectBase

#camelcase, #to_b, #to_params

Instance Attribute Details

#multicast_ipObject

Returns the value of attribute multicast_ip.



16888
16889
16890
# File 'lib/kaltura_types.rb', line 16888

def multicast_ip
  @multicast_ip
end

#multicast_portObject

Returns the value of attribute multicast_port.



16889
16890
16891
# File 'lib/kaltura_types.rb', line 16889

def multicast_port
  @multicast_port
end

Instance Method Details

#from_xml(xml_element) ⇒ Object



16895
16896
16897
16898
16899
16900
16901
16902
16903
# File 'lib/kaltura_types.rb', line 16895

def from_xml(xml_element)
	super
	if xml_element.elements['multicastIP'] != nil
		self.multicast_ip = xml_element.elements['multicastIP'].text
	end
	if xml_element.elements['multicastPort'] != nil
		self.multicast_port = xml_element.elements['multicastPort'].text
	end
end